In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ding BN20 9LS,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.8%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 55.1% | 53.8% | -1.3% | 51.0% | 2.8% |
| Male | 44.9% | 46.2% | 1.3% | 49.0% | -2.8%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Meachants Lane was 89.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 122.0% higher than the Lower Willingdon average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.
Meachants Lane has the 4th highest crime rate of 28 local areas in Lower Willingdon and the 51st highest crime rate of 494 local areas in Wealden .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 26.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has stayed broadly stable by about 0.0%.
